Cosmetic dentistry billing has its own failure points; different from a routine filling. A veneer case billed incorrectly as a crown to squeeze out insurance reimbursement invites a fraud inquiry, not just a denial. A treatment plan that doesn’t clearly separate the covered periodontal work from the purely elective gum contouring next to it leaves both the practice and the patient confused about what’s actually owed. And because so much cosmetic dentistry in California is financed through CareCredit or similar credit products, the billing team also has to get the state’s patient-facing disclosure paperwork right. Not just the coding.

Cosmetic Dentistry Billing and Coding CA: What Actually Goes Wrong
California cosmetic billing becomes complicated long before a claim reaches the insurer. Most practices run into the same four problems.
1. Financing Compliance
Cosmetic treatment is often financed rather than insured. California requires practices to provide compliant financing disclosures, written treatment plans, cost estimates, and signed patient acknowledgments before credit is offered.
2. Covered vs. Cosmetic Treatment
Many treatment plans combine restorative and elective procedures. Billing records need to show exactly which services qualify for insurance and which remain the patient’s responsibility to reduce audit risk and payment disputes.
3. Medical and Dental Cross Coding
Procedures such as full mouth rehabilitation, Invisalign, or sedation can include both medically necessary and cosmetic elements. Missing that distinction can either reduce reimbursement or result in denied claims.
4. Patient Balance Management
Large veneer or smile makeover cases depend heavily on financing and payment plans. A capable billing partner should be just as comfortable reconciling financing accounts and following up on patient balances as submitting insurance claims.

Cosmetic dentistry billing in California isn’t really about chasing insurance denials; most of the time, there’s no insurance claim to chase. It’s about getting the financing paperwork right under AB 171, keeping itemized treatment plans clean enough that patients know exactly what they’re paying for, and not letting cosmetic and covered procedures blur together on the same claim.
